A home in the Scottish Highlands.
A traditional Scottish house in the Cairngorms National Park. The house is situated on a quiet road overlooking the Hills of Cromdale.
It is 9 miles from Aviemore and 4 miles from Grantown-on-Spey. Great for exploring the Cairngorms National Park and the Moray Coast.
An ideal location for visiting local attractions, woodland walks, lochs, distilleries, and castles. Driving distance to ski resorts, golf courses, and many other outdoor activities.

About the area
Located in Grantown-on-Spey, this holiday home is in a rural area and on a river. Grantown Museum and Tomintoul Museum are cultural highlights, and some of the area's activities can be experienced at Abernethy Golf Club and Boat of Garten Golf Club. Craig MacLean Leisure Centre and Landmark Forest Adventure Park are also worth visiting.
